Home

England Leyland General Business Croston Caravan Storage

Croston Caravan Storage in Leyland, England

Croston Caravan Storage with information like telephone number, maps, postcode, address and related useful information.

Croston Caravan Storage

Address: Station Rd Croston

Postcode: PR26 9RJ

City/Town: Leyland, England , UK

Category:General Business

Get simple code & place at your website

Claim your Listing

Logo